Mini Bio. John Rox was born on June 21, 1907 in Des Moines, Iowa, USA. He was a writer, known for Rhythm Inn (1951), An Angel Comes to Brooklyn (1945) and A Safe Place (1971). He was married to Alice Pearce. He died on August 5, 1957 in Fire Island, New York, USA.
John Rox " I Want a Hippopotamus for Christmas " is a Christmas novelty song written by John Rox (1902–1957) [1] [2] [3] [4] [5] [6] [7] and performed by 10-year-old Gayla Peevey in 1953. The song peaked at number 24 on Billboard magazine's pop chart in December 1953.

11 de oct. de 2023 · John Rox (born John Jefferson Barber Herring, 21 June 1907, Des Moines, Iowa – 5 August 1957, Fire Island, N.Y.) was an American song writer. Mr. Rox graduated from Drake College. One of his most popular song hits was It's a Big, Wide, Wonderful World. He also wrote the novelty song I Want a Hippopotamus for Christmas.
